By using AI to develop training tools, directions to carry out tasks, as well as to help evaluate employee progress productivity businesses can save time and money. Things like taking inventory in ordering can be made much simpler using AI.
In education I personally am excited for the UBAI team to help speech language pathologist with kindergarten screening, collecting language samples, and especially online therapy that students can do independently. Seeing students in a group is not always appropriate for their needs, but with the amount of students we have it is a necessity. With AI presenting practice activities for articulation and language and Recording student responses, the SLP will have time to work with other students on instruction in a more appropriate way. If I have three students using AI to practice their speech sounds, I can spend individual time with a student helping them shape their tongue using mirrors and tools for the correct sound before they go off to practice. I could see this being used in a full classroom as well for teachers. Rather than meeting one on one with each student which takes a long time, students can participate in reading, knowledge, etc. activities using AI on their iPads at their seats giving the teacher much more individual time with students.
